Before diving into the buying process, it's essential to understand the US stock market. It's made up of several major exchanges, including the New York Stock Exchange (NYSE) and the NASDAQ. These exchanges list stocks from various industries, including technology, healthcare, finance, and more.

One challenge of buying US stocks from Saudi Arabia is currency conversion. The US dollar is the currency used in the stock market, so you'll need to convert your Saudi riyals to US dollars. Be aware of the conversion rates and any fees associated with currency exchange.

When buying US stocks from Saudi Arabia, it's important to understand the tax implications. You'll need to pay taxes on any dividends or capital gains you earn from your investments. Consult with a tax professional to ensure you're compliant with Saudi and US tax laws.
